From 6a010b47b216c5a6b6e85abcfbba5339bab15dd6 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Bernhard Schommer Date: Thu, 19 Oct 2017 13:08:13 +0200 Subject: New support for inserting ais-annotations. The ais annotations can be inserted via the new ais variants of the builtin annotation. They mainly differe in that they have an address format specifier '%addr' which will be replaced by the adress in the binary.
